Welcome to Demon School! Iruma-kun (Mairimashita! Iruma-kun) has become a modern staple of the supernatural comedy genre. Following the journey of a kind-hearted human boy sold to a demon by his neglectful parents, the series balances high-stakes magical action with heartwarming “found family” dynamics.

Synopsis & Plot Summary

Iruma Suzuki is a 14-year-old human who has spent his life working hard to survive his parents’ selfishness. His life takes a literal turn for the underworld when his parents sell his soul to the demon Lord Sullivan. Surprisingly, Sullivan doesn’t want to eat him—he wants to adopt him as his grandson.

Iruma is enrolled in the Babyls School for Demons, where he must hide his human identity. If discovered, he could be eaten. However, despite his desire to stay low-profile, Iruma’s innate kindness and “overwhelming crisis evasion capability” lead him to rise through the demon ranks, make eccentric friends, and accidentally become a candidate for the next Demon King.
